One of the main reasons why zinc oxide is so widely used in skincare is its ability to provide broad-spectrum protection against harmful UV rays. As a physical sunscreen ingredient, zinc oxide sits on the surface of the skin and reflects the sun’s rays away from the skin, preventing sunburn and other forms of sun damage. Unlike chemical sunscreens, which absorb UV rays and convert them into heat, zinc oxide provides immediate protection without causing irritation or sensitization.

In addition to its sun-protective properties, zinc oxide also has an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ial benefits. This makes it an excellent ingredient for treating acne, eczema, and other inflammatory skin conditions. By reducing inflammation and killing bacteria on the skin’s surface, zinc oxide can help alleviate redness, swelling, and irritation, promoting faster healing and smoother skin texture.

Zinc oxide is also a popular ingredient in diaper rash creams because of its soothing and healing properties. It forms a protective barrier on the skin, preventing moisture from irritating the skin and causing further inflammation. This barrier function also makes zinc oxide a great choice for sensitive skin types, as it helps lock in moisture and prevent transepidermal water loss.
